Slow Down and Back Off

Rain reduces traction, which means your tires don’t grip the road as well. That makes your vehicle more prone to sliding – especially when braking or turning.

Use Low Beams, Not High Beams

Visibility is a significant concern when driving in wet weather, particularly in the morning or evening. Headlights should always be activated with your wipers – this fulfills the law in Virginia and helps other drivers to see you.

Don’t Skip the Tire Check

Tires are your first defense on slick roads. If they’re worn or improperly inflated, you increase the risk of hydroplaning – a situation where your vehicle glides over water instead of gripping the road.

Avoid Standing Water

Even a few inches of water can hide potholes, damage your vehicle, or cause loss of control. Avoid puddles or standing water when possible.

Keep Your Windshield Clear

Seeing clearly is half the battle. Make sure your wiper blades are in good shape, your defroster works, and your washer fluid is topped off.

Inspect Your Brakes and Suspension

In the rain, your safety depends heavily on two key systems: your brakes and suspension. If either of these systems is worn, you will not be able to have the necessary control or stop as quickly as you should.

Modern Tech Helps – But Don’t Rely on It Alone

Toyota’s modern safety features – like Traction Control, ABS, and Toyota Safety Sense™ – are fantastic, but they don’t replace good driving habits. Let them support your safe driving, not do the job for you.
